Interventions
COMBINATION_PRODUCT

SBRT+Toripalimab Plus Docetaxel and Cisplatin

All participants will receive SBRT (18Gy/3 fractions, QOD ) to gross tumor and metastatic lymph nodes, followed by neoadjuvant chemoimmunotherapy of Toripalimab (240mg) Plus Docetaxel (75mg/m2, q3w) and Cisplatin (75mg/m2, q3w) for 3 cycles. If tumor has complete or partial response at 2 weeks after the last course of neoadjuvant chemotherapy, participants will then receive intensity modulated radiotherapy (54Gy/27 fractions). If tumor is stable or progressive, participants will receive radical resection with or without postoperative intensity modulated radiotherapy when necessary.
